Full Job Description
RK&K has an immediate opportunity for a result-driven Senior Project Manager to join our Environmental Services group that supports RK&K's public and private sector client needs in its US operations. The candidate is responsible for leading and/or working collaboratively with a multi-discipline project team to capture, develop, and implement environmental due diligence, contaminant investigation, remediation, permitting, and facility compliance evaluations supporting infrastructure improvement, real estate transactions, and civil engineering projects. We seek a candidate with proven client and project management experience complemented with strong technical skills. The ideal candidate is highly communicative, able to develop creative technical solutions, takes initiative, and seeks an opportunity to help build RK&K's environmental services.

Essential Functions

As a Senior Manager, you will identify and deliver multi-discipline projects/tasks supporting public and private-sector client projects.
  • Direct, lead, and implement concurrent environmental services projects/tasks
  • Assist in identifying and capturing work for requiring environmental services
  • Possess a firm understanding of governing Federal and State regulations, standards, and guidance such as OSHA, ASTM standards, state DOT clearances/permits, etc.
  • Assess and interpret data, analyzes, reports/communicates alternatives and potential impacts to colleagues, clients, and stakeholders
  • Develop project budgets and track various metrics
  • Collaborate with others to prepare technical reports/memoranda offering solutions to client projects
  • Serve as liaison between clients and firm
  • Manage and mentor staff throughout our organization
  • Participate in group planning, budgeting, and strategic planning
  • Lead/participate in proposal and marketing efforts and client management

Required Skills and Experience
  • Bachelor of Science degree in Environmental Science, Engineering, Biology, Geology, or Earth Sciences
  • Professional license, professional registration, and/or certification (PE, PG, CHMM, CSP, CIH, etc.)
  • 15+ years of environmental services and both personnel and client management experience
  • Demonstrated experience working in a highly collaborative, team-based environment
  • Strong oral and written communications skills with experience in client coordination and communications
  • Ability to manage direct work and work by others against schedules and established budgets
